Output d4534eea5d90bc455a700692ec65c67ac1b7588fc7e35fe9dd51669f1865ce51:8

value
2652569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fbf09a67b26ecbd5148aea60d7a8a37c2ca06a OP_EQUAL
address
3QPXKCtVo7fntsryZSMFagsjaJXE6MCBPs
transaction
d4534eea5d90bc455a700692ec65c67ac1b7588fc7e35fe9dd51669f1865ce51
spent
true